The book tells the story of Marsy, a little alien from Mars who travels to Earth and meets siblings Luni and Wenny there. Marsy has red skin, black ant eyes, and two antennae on her head, while Luni has red hair, light skin, and blue eyes, and Wenny is dark-skinned with brown eyes and short black hair. The book begins with Marsy, Luni and Wenny meeting for the first time and becoming instant friends. They explore the garden together and tell each other stories about their home planets. The friendship between the three grows fast and they decide to embark on an exciting space journey together. Marsy, who comes from Mars, helps them build a spaceship and they embark on an adventure in space. During their journey they visit different planets, discover fascinating worlds and friendly aliens. You experience many exciting adventures and learn a lot about yourself and the universe. Eventually, after some time, they return to Earth and are warmly welcomed by their families. They share their experiences and gifts from outer space. At the end of the book, it is emphasized that the friendship between Marsy, Luni, and Wenny is strong and enduring. They promise each other to always be there for each other and to experience many more adventures together. The book conveys important messages about friendship, cooperation and the joy of discovering and exploring new worlds. It inspires readers to pursue their dreams and appreciate the diversity of the universe
